    On his podcast Jim Ross claims that the short scuffle started over Ric Flair's comments made in his book referring to Mick Foley as just a "glorified stuntman." Mick went to Vince voicing his opinion insisting that WWE give superstars an early copy of books that have statements made about them before release. Flair seen it as him trying to create heat so Flair swung at Mick.

      SFFL 1996 The idea is that the winner gets over and thus makes more money, but in order to get over he needs to have a good match. The guy who does the job doesn't get to sell more merchandise and get on the Fruity Pebbles box, so it's a matter of showing appreciation for the help.
      If the product you sell is wrestling, it just makes sense to make it the best possible product and then divide up the profit among those who contributed, right?
      If you're just getting paid to lose rather than put the winner over, might as well kick Daniel Bryan's head off in 18 seconds in every match. One guy does the job and nobody wins.
